Ludhiana Trust Assesses Crore-Worth Properties Before Court Ruling

LUDHIANA: The Ludhiana Improvement Trust (LIT) has begun an extensive assessment of its key real estate holdings, including the long-dormant City Centre building in Shaheed Bhagat Singh (SBS) Nagar. This initiative is part of the Trust’s efforts to prepare for potential significant legal outcomes and to raise funds for city development through upcoming auctions. The evaluation encompasses several valuable properties, including the multi-storey building on Rani Jhansi Road, the Trust’s headquarters in Ferozepur Gandhi Market, and the 25.5-acre City Centre project on Pakhowal Road. Borrowing Limits Raised to $1 Billion, ETRealty

MUMBAI: The Reserve Bank of India has released updated guidelines for External Commercial Borrowings (ECBs), revising limits, relaxing maturity requirements, and eliminating cost caps. Under these new regulations, eligible borrowers can secure ECBs up to the greater of $1 billion in outstanding borrowings or 300% of their net worth as per the most recent audited balance sheet. Previously, the borrowing cap was set at $750 million. Maharashtra Forms Panel to Review TDR Relief for Redevelopment

PUNE: The state government has established a 12-member committee to re-survey river flood lines across Maharashtra, including areas in Pune and Pimpri Chinchwad, nearly a year after making this commitment in the assembly. The panel is expected to submit its report within two months. The government has tasked the committee with reviewing current regulations and suggesting amendments to the Unified Development Control and Promotion Regulations (UDCPR) to facilitate the use of Transfer of Development Rights (TDR) for properties built within flood lines prior to the irrigation department’s demarcation in 2009. Eden Realty Group to invest ₹5,000 crore in projects by 2030

KOLKATA: Eden Realty Group announced on Tuesday a substantial investment of ₹5,000 crore aimed at developing residential, commercial, and hospitality projects along both banks of the Hooghly River by 2030. The initiative includes a premium riverside residential complex in Howrah’s Shalimar, as well as five luxury hotels offering a total of 600 rooms in Kolkata, Howrah, and South 24 Parganas, as disclosed by Eden Realty MD Arya Sumant. “For the first time, we are venturing into the hospitality sector with plans to establish five luxury hotels on land leased from SMPK (Kolkata Port). Keystone Realtors to Redevelop 8 Housing Societies in Andheri East

MUMBAI: Keystone Realtors has been awarded a significant redevelopment project for Om Nagar Co-operative Housing Society Federation in Andheri (East), Mumbai, with an estimated gross development value of approximately ₹1,775 crore. The project entails the redevelopment of eight housing societies, covering a total land area of around 20,569.90 square meters. As reported by the company, the redevelopment will facilitate the rehabilitation of 637 current members from these societies, and it is projected to create a free-sale potential of about five lakh square feet of carpet area. 2,000 Mumbai Redevelopment Projects’ Debris Reported Missing

Representative AI image MUMBAI: A civic investigation has revealed that tonnes of construction debris from nearly 2,000 redevelopment projects intended for designated disposal sites have not been reaching their intended locations, according to officials from Mumbai Mirror. Environmentalists suspect that this waste has been sold to land mafia for illegal encroachment on Mumbai’s mangrove and wetland areas. YEIDA earns ₹389 crore from Noida airport plot e-auction

Representative AI image NOIDA: The Yamuna Expressway Industrial Development Authority (YEIDA) raised a total of ₹389 crore from the e-auction of three group housing plots spanning approximately 13 acres. The combined reserve price for these plots was set at ₹283 crore, with final bids surpassing this figure by ₹106 crore, significantly boosting the authority’s revenue from the auction held on Friday. Provence Developers acquired one plot with a bid of ₹95 crore, Eldeco Infrastructure & Properties bid ₹105 crore, and Northwind Estate topped the auction with a bid of ₹189 crore.
